- 1、本文档共17页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
FILENAME visual basic程序设计教学大纲
第 PAGE 17 页 共 NUMPAGES 17 页
《Visual Basic程序设计》教学大纲
(供四年制大学 专业使用)
一、课程目标
1、课程的性质和目的(宋体 五号加粗)
随着计算机技术的广泛应用,学生在具备一定的计算机知识和应用能力的基础上,应当进一步学习并掌握一门计算机高级程序设计语言。Visual Basic(简称VB)是一种有代表性的较为流行的、可视化的、面向对象的程序设计语言,是设计Windows应用程序的重要工具。利用它使得创建具有专业外观的用户界面的编程工作简单易行。Visual Basic程序设计语言,它具有易于掌握、使用方便、功能强大等优点。
《Visual Basic程序设计》课程是本院计算机技术、信息管理与信息系统专业的专业基础课之一。通过本课程的教学,能使学生在计算机文化基础上对计算机的应用有更进一步的了解和掌握,学生通过本课程的学习和示例的分析,掌握使用Visual Basic开发Windows应用程序的一般方法和特点,理解Windows应用程序的基本概念、主要功能和Windows应用程序开发的基本思想,特别是要掌握计算机的可视化界面设计、结构化程序设计的语句、常用算法和编程思想。能够根据实际需要自行开发简单的Windows应用程序,并为今后进一步使用Visual Basic或其他面向对象的可视化开发工具开发Windows应用程序打下基础。
本课程主要讲授以下内容:VB的基本概念(窗口,控件,事件,属性,方法,菜单及VB运行环境),VB的基本语法(相关语句,运算符,表达式,变量的作用域,数组,函数和过程及程序设计的基本结构),输入和输出(inputbox,mesagebox,print方法,利用文本框输入数据的方法),标准控件的使用(各标准控件的属性的设置、方法的使用、事件的编程),绘图(绘图常用函数,方法), 文件系统(顺序文件,随机文件,二进制文件的概念及操作),数据库编程。
课程的教学要求在每一知识单元中给出,大体上分为三个层次:了解、熟悉和掌握。了解即能正确判别有关概念和方法;熟悉是能正确表达有关概念和方法的含义;掌握是在理解的基础上加以灵活应用。
2、本课程与其它课程的联系(宋体 五号加粗)
它以计算机导论、信息技术基础课为先修课程,它为学生以后学习数据库原理、操作系统等课程打好基础。
二、课程学时分配
《Visual Basic程序设计》以课堂讲授为主,总学时63学时,其中理论讲授36学时,上机实验27学时。课程主要内容和学时分配见课程学时分配表。(宋体五号)
课程学时分配表(宋体五号,加黑)
教学环节
时数
课程内容
理论
实践教学
习题及讨论
小计
实验
实训
见习
其他
第一单元 认识Visual Basic
3
3
6
第二单元 Visual Basic语言基础
6
3
9
第三单元 三种基本结构的程序设计
6
6
12
第四单元 数组、过程、数据文件
8
3
12
第五单元 绘图、菜单及其他常用控件和语句
9
9
18
第六单元 数据库编程
3
3
6
总 计
35
27
63
三、建议教材和教学参考书目(黑体小四号)
教材(宋体 五号加粗)
罗朝盛《Visual Basic 6.0程序设计教程》(第三版)北京 人民邮电出版社 2008年12月
2.主要参考书(宋体 五号加粗)
林卓然 《Visual Basic 6.0程序设计教程》(第2版).北京 电子工业出版社 2007年12月
刘柄文 《Visual Basic程序设计教程》 北京 清华大学出版社 2003年
李雁翎 《Visual Basic程序设计教程》北京 清华大学出版社 2004年7月
四、课程考核(黑体小四号)
《Visual Basic程序设计》为考试课。既在课程结束后一次性闭卷考试为主,并结合课堂提问、平时作业以及上机操作等方面的考查,综合评定成绩。
五、课程教学内容及基本要求(黑体小四号)
第一单元 认识 Visual Basic
【目的要求】
掌握
启动 Visual Basic;
对象和事件的基本概念。
熟悉
Visual Basic 6.0的特点;
Visual Basic的集成开发环境。
了解
程序设计语言的发展;
Visual Basic发展过程;
Visual Basic的工程管理。
【教学内容】
第1章 认识 Visual Basic
1.1 程序设计语言
一、三种程序设计语言
二、高级语言的两种翻译方式
三、面向过程和面向对象(两种程序设计方法)
1 面向过程程序设计(传统方法)
2 面向对象程序设计
1.2 VB概述
一、Visual Basic的发展过程
二、Visual Basic的
您可能关注的文档
- 《编译原理》课程教学大纲--供四年制计算机科学与技术(医药软件开发)专业使用.doc
- 《大学体育》教学大纲--供本、专科使用.doc
- 《电路与电子技术》教学大纲--供2+2中韩国际合作、制药工程专业使用.doc
- 《电路原理》课程教学大纲--供四年制计算机科学与技术专业(医药软件开发)使用.doc
- 《管理信息系统》教学大纲--供四年制信息管理与信息系统专业使用.doc
- 《汇编语言程序设计》课程教学大纲--供四年制计算机科学与技术医药软件方向、计算机涉外、信息监理等专业使用.doc
- 《基础医学概论》教学大纲.doc
- 《计算方法》课程教学大纲.doc
- 《计算机网络》教学大纲.doc
- 《计算机系统结构》教学大纲.doc
文档评论(0)